Output ecfa783b3555906fa6cd9301bff77f9c71f4fd89bbd2f1145556d015bda3919e:45

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ff49c75f52c7eccb501db8ef3e146ce0aa148a8 OP_EQUAL
address
3HjPCzkNExjQREhm6gFKep9ST5Nf5KCieR
transaction
ecfa783b3555906fa6cd9301bff77f9c71f4fd89bbd2f1145556d015bda3919e
spent
true